The Car Behind This Bag
1985 · 3.5L M30 inline-six · Dingolfing · E24 chassis · the "Shark
Built on the E24 platform from 1976 to 1989, the 6 Series was BMW's grand-touring coupé — the long-bonneted, wedge-nosed silhouette that earned it the nickname "the Shark." By 1985, the 635 CSi sat near the top of the range with the 3.5-litre M30 inline-six, an engine that has become one of the most rebuildable in modern automotive history.
The 6 Series was the yuppie dream car of the late 1980s — Wall Street, Miami Vice, and every architect's parking spot from Munich to Manhattan. The car appeared in Star Trek IV: The Voyage Home parked outside Spock's house. Its Group A racing version, with Schnitzer-prepared engines and BMW Motorsport livery, won the European Touring Car Championship in 1981 with Helmut Kelleners and Umberto Grano at the wheel.
Today the 635 CSi survives as a Sunday classic — long, low, and somehow still timeless. The interior is where the brand was at its peak: pinstripe velour or supple leather, Recaro buckets in higher trim, and the kind of switchgear that aged better than the cars built around it.
